Transcriptomic Remodeling and Survival Strategies of Extensively Drug-Res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ae Under Meropenem Pressure
2025-05-05
Abstract excerpt
Klebsiella pneumoniae is an opportunistic pathogen of great medical relevance due to its high virulence and resistance to antimicrobials. Carbapenem resistance is mediated by carbapenemases and represents a global clinical challenge due to the limited therapeutic arsenal.
